Shawn and I got together again to do another Trail Tales: ARP episode!

If you’ve been struggling and dealing with one issue or setback after another, then consider listening to this episode.

I share about not fun things that have popped up in my life and how they’ve impacted my running and racing. – Including my terrible experience with a race volunteer at a 50 miler that led to a DNF.

You might be able to relate in one way or another.

If you’re a mother runner, I especially encourage you to listen.

After doing this episode, I went out and set two Fastest Known Time records on the North Country Trail in Moraine State Park and McConnell’s Mill State Park. If you want, check that out here.

I hope that you find this talk inspiring. Keep moving forward even when difficult times feel relentless.
